Data Protection for Councils Part 1 - foundations and theory - delivered by Breakthrough Communications

In an ever-evolving legislative landscape, it is vital that councils ensure they have the most up-to-date understanding of their data protection obligations. This introductory session walks councils through the theory and core principles of GDPR and related data protection legislation, and we explain what policies, practices and processes councils need to have in place.

Data Protection for Councils Part 2 - accountability and lawfulness - delivered by Breakthrough Communications

Our second data protection session deep dives into how councils are required to demonstrate accountability with UK GDPR. We consider the different lawful bases for how councils process personal data and how to get started with creating the different policies and documents required, including your Privacy Notice, Legitimate Interest and Data Protection Impact Assessments.

Data Protection for Councils Part 3 - data subject rights and information security - delivered by Breakthrough Communications

Our third data protection session considers how to deal with data subject rights requests, including Subject Access Requests. We explore specific steps to take to ensure you are compliant with the legislation, and we consider what exemptions may apply, and when. We also explore the importance of Information Security for local councils and what this means in practice.

Data Protection training for Parish and Town Councillors - delivered by Breakthrough Communications

Whether you are an experienced councillor or have only recently been elected, it is vital that you understand how data protection legislation sits with your role as an elected member.  This session will help you understand your legal obligations to yourself and to your council and how to get things right, as well as introducing Freedom of Information and what this means for councillors.

Freedom of Information for local councils - obligations, procedures and exemptions - delivered by Breakthrough Communications

This course looks at what requirements and obligations local councils have when it comes to Freedom of Information. We look at what policies and procedures councils should have in place, how to ensure officers and councillors are aware of their obligations and what steps to take when you get an FOI request, and what exemptions may potentially apply and when.
